NLN Foundation Joins the Global Giving Tuesday Movement

November 21, 2017 Posted by Industry News Celebrations - Awareness, HIT Feed, News, Nursing, Nursing-Edu

Pledges to Raise $25,000 to Support the Next Generation of Nursing Educators

NLN Foundation for Nursing Education (@NLNursing) has again joined the Giving Tuesday movement, a global day of giving that harnesses the collective power of individuals, communities, and organizations to encourage philanthropy and to celebrate generosity worldwide. Occurring this year on November, 28, Giving Tuesday is held annually on the Tuesday following Thanksgiving (in the US) and the widely recognized shopping events, Black Friday and Cyber Monday.

Through #NLNGivingTuesday, the NLN Foundation is raising awareness and funds engaging with individuals and organization through social media. Participants may donate; take action on the NLN Advocacy Action Center, post an #UnSelfie, call, text, or email friends and colleagues with NLN ready-to-send messages about the importance of providing financial support for the future of nursing education. The goal of the NLN Foundation is to raise $25,000 from #NLNGivingTuesday efforts. All funds will support the NLN Foundation’s nurse educator scholarships and other important programs that promote excellence in nursing education. Collectively, these programs advance the health of our nation and the global community.

About the NLN Foundation for Nursing Education
The NLN Foundation for Nursing Education, works to raise, steward, and distribute funds to support the mission of the National League for Nursing: promoting excellence in nursing education; building a strong and diverse nursing workforce; advancing the health of our nation and the global community. The NLN Foundation collaborates with partners in various industries to empower nurse educators through scholarships and research initiatives that change the landscape of nursing education. As the preeminent funder of scholarships, grants, research, and faculty development programs, the NLN Foundation is committed to empowering nurse educators today and for generations to come.
